Transaction 773f90d651888fab2218d14e8a2b9b5df609e0b7d90c8ebeb8d4476f135081b5
1 Input
1 Output
-
773f90d651888fab2218d14e8a2b9b5df609e0b7d90c8ebeb8d4476f135081b5:0
- value
- 1558988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5e51dd06c1a285c4f18e62e9b5337e31f3e81ea OP_EQUAL
- address
- 3KjPWdDMB5B9mpt7AyCm35k2ayyavBappw